The Complete Man...


I am always fascinated by the Raymonds advertisement, not because of the fabric or their designs but by the content and the way they capture the emotions of characters and various beautiful moments in life. This made me to think on what makes “The Complete Man” to exist or is this term just a hypothetical one. 

The Raymonds advertisement, pictures various stages of a Man’s life, a doting father, spontaneous and surprising boyfriend, loving husband, caring son, affectionate student. Yes Raymonds protagonist is the quintessential person whom everyone would love to have on their side. 
In one of the Raymond advertisement which is also my favourite, we have a hubby who reaches home to find a note from his wife saying, 

“Working Late…. Enjoy your office party.. PS: Can’t dance anyway” 

He looks at it, smiles and then reaches her office with a red rose in his hand, gives her the rose and they dance together. Though the entire picturisation has been taken from “Shall We Dance” movie, it definitively passes on the message that nothing is more important than the family. The other one shows a son handing over his appointment order to his mother. His mother delighted on this gets sad on seeing that his son posting is in Singapore. Though unable to show her sadness, she wishes all the best to her son. He at that moment produces two tickets for Singapore which includes one for his mother. On seeing this, his mother’s eyes are overwhelmed with joyful tears. At that moment, he bends down and touches his feet for her blessings. The ad ends with the complete man tag. Yes this is what our parents expect from our grownups. The caring that we need to shower on them. The assurance that we are there for them and care for them at all times. 

Other Raymond ads such as remembering old teacher for the wedding, outperforming Dad’s expectations and daughter’s wedding. Each ad lays emphasis on a particular aspect of life. After watching all the ads, a Complete man is one who has all the above characteristics.
